@charset "iso-8859-1";
/* CSS Document */

/* TABLAS */
body
{
	font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;
	color: #000;
}

.calendar
{
	width:90px;
	height:18px;
	padding-left:2px;
	background-image:url(img/calendar.png);
	background-repeat:no-repeat;
	background-position:95% center;
	cursor:pointer;
}

.tabla1
{
	border-collapse:collapse;
	border: 1px solid #CCC;
}
.tabla01
{
	border-collapse:collapse;
	border: 1px solid #CCC;
}

.tablaNuevo
{
	border-collapse:collapse;
	border: 1px solid #1CA4A1;
}

.cabeceraTabla01
{
	font-size:14px;
	color:#FFF;
	background-image:url(img/bg_bar2.jpg);
	background-repeat:repeat-x;
}

.cabeceraTablaTicket
{
	font-size:14px;
	color:#FFF;
	background-image:url(img/bg_bar_ticket2.jpg);
	background-repeat:repeat-x;
}
.cabeceraTablaTicket2
{
	font-size:14px;
	color:#FFF;
	background-image:url(img/bg_bar_ticket.jpg);
	background-repeat:repeat-x;
}

.cabeceraTabla
{
	font-size:14px;
	font-weight:bold;
	color:#FFF;
	background-color:#1CA4A1;
}


.filaTabla01
{
	font-size:12px;
	color:#333;
	text-decoration:none;
}

.cabeceraTablaAvisos
{
	font-size:14px;
	font-weight:bold;
	color:#FFF;
	background-color:#1CA4A1;
}

.filaAviso01
{
	font-size:12px;
	color:#333;
	text-decoration:none;
}
.filaAviso01:hover
{
	background-color:#FFC;
}

.tituloFormulario
{
	font-size:14px;
	color:#1CA4A1;
}

.datosReserva
{
	font-size:16px;
	color:#666;
}

.tituloPagina
{
	font-size:18px;
	color:#1CA4A1;
}

.tituloPanel
{
	font-size:22px;
	color:#333;
}

.avisoProceso
{
	font-size:14px;
	color:#666;
}

.alertaRoja
{
	color:#B30000;
	font-size:12px;
	font-weight:bold;
}
.alertaVerde
{
	color:#008000;
	font-size:12px;
	font-weight:bold;
}
.nuevoForm
{
	color:#FFF;
	font-size:16px;
}
.criteriosBusquedas
{
	color:#666;
	font-size:12px;
}

.nuevorow
{
	cursor:pointer;
	background-image:url(img/bg_bar.jpg);
	background-repeat:repeat-x;
	color:#FFF;
}

.tituloFormulario
{
	color:#E95D2C;
	font-weight:bold;
	font-size:16px;
}

.botonDefault
{
	border: 1px solid #ccc;
	text-align:center;
	font-size:16px;
	font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;
	background-color:#E95D2C;
	color:#FFF;
	cursor:pointer;
	padding:5px 15px 5px 15px;
	
	-webkit-border-radius: 10px 0px 10px 0px;
	-moz-border-radius: 10px 0px 10px 0px;
	border-radius: 10px 0px 10px 0px;
	
	-webkit-transition: all 0.3s;
    -moz-transition: all 0.3s;
    transition: all 0.3s;

}

.botonDefault:hover
{
	border: 1px solid #ccc;
	background-color:#CCC;
	color:#FFF;
	
	-webkit-border-radius: 0px 10px 0px 10px;
	-moz-border-radius: 0px 10px 0px 10px;
	border-radius: 0px 10px 0px 10px;
}
